Output 67113a5d80a6abe3bc32504e7d0ff032f566aa964a5dbcb271de27bfc72f6c72:8

value
1634138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d40f23b99d1d16d842f48d4149313021c4d4586e OP_EQUAL
address
3M2HK8Gwwfwr6eeZVC4UBvJYAG7aX3JDrB
transaction
67113a5d80a6abe3bc32504e7d0ff032f566aa964a5dbcb271de27bfc72f6c72
spent
true